Choosing between the Jawa 350 vs Jawa 42 Bobber? BikeJunction is here to help! The 350 starts at ₹ 1.83 Lakh, while the 42 Bobber is priced at ₹ 2.03 Lakh (ex-showroom). You can easily compare all the required parameters for your new two-wheeler. These two-wheelers have powerful motors with good performance. Among them, the 350 offers 28.1 Nm torque. The 42 Bobber gives 30 Nm torque. Apart from all this, you can pick from 7 colour options for the 350 and 5 for the 42 Bobber. you will get a more extensive comparison of Jawa 350 and Jawa 42 Bobber, which will definitely clear your confusion between these two-wheelers.

Relaxed Power for Long Rides

The Jawa 350 feels solid and stable on the road. Its 334cc engine focuses on smooth torque delivery, making long rides comfortable. The bike feels best when ridden at a steady pace. I enjoy the relaxed seating and classic design, which make highway cruising calm and stress-free.

Stable Cruiser Designed For Highway Comfort

I recently upgraded to the Jawa 350, and the 184 kg kerb weight provides amazing stability on the highway. It returns 24 kmpl mileage, and the slipper clutch makes my heavy traffic commutes much less tiring for my hands. The 790 mm seat is great, and the 178 mm ground clearance is quite practical.
